From point A that is 8.2 meters above level groundthe angle of elevation of the top of the building is 31degrees20 minutes and the angle of depression of the base of the building is 12 degrees 50?

To find the height of the building, we can use trigonometry. The angle of elevation (31°20') allows us to calculate the height above point A to the top of the building, while the angle of depression (12°50') helps us find the height from point A to the base of the building. By applying the tangent function for both angles and considering the height of point A (8.2 meters), we can derive the heights from these angles and find the total height of the building.
